It's actually a Cayman flag. It is much better for tax purposes to register luxury vessels in Cayman (or Panama, or the Bahamas) than in the U.S.

From the registry report: "The Country the Yacht is Flagged in: Cayman Islands - The official registry port is George Town and her home port is Fort Lauderdale, USA - Class society used: LR (Lloyds Register)"

the Cayman Islands is a British Overseas Territory located in the western Caribbean Sea.
